private void barbtnSalvar_Click(object sender, EventArgs e) { if (VerificaDadosObrigatorios()) { int id = opcaoAcesso.Codigo; opcaoAcesso = new classeOpcaoAcesso() { Codigo = id, CodigoTag = Convert.ToInt32(TextboxTag.Text), Descricao = TextBoxDescricao.Text }; if (id == 0) { dbOpcaoAcesso.insereOpcaoAcessoBase(opcaoAcesso); } else { dbOpcaoAcesso.alteraOpcaoAcessoBase(opcaoAcesso); } HabilitaBotoesMenu(true); HabilitaCamposDados(false); LimpaCamposDados(); AtualizaDadosGrid(); } else { MessageBox.Show("Dados Obrigatórios não informados ", "Urgente!!", MessageBoxButtons.OK, MessageBoxIcon.Error); } }
public classeOpcaoAcesso RetornaDadosObjeto(classeOpcaoAcesso OpcaoAcesso) { MySqlDataAdapter adapter = new MySqlDataAdapter(); DataSet ds = new DataSet(); classeOpcaoAcesso OpcaoAcessoTemp = new classeOpcaoAcesso(); string sql = "select opcaoacessoid, opcaoacessotag, opcaoacessodescricao from opcaoacesso where opcaoacessoid = " + OpcaoAcesso.Codigo + ";"; adapter = connect.retornaSQL(sql); adapter.Fill(ds); OpcaoAcessoTemp.Codigo = OpcaoAcesso.Codigo; OpcaoAcessoTemp.CodigoTag = Convert.ToInt32(ds.Tables[0].Rows[0][1].ToString()); OpcaoAcessoTemp.Descricao = (ds.Tables[0].Rows[0][2].ToString()); return(OpcaoAcessoTemp); }
private void LimpaCamposDados() { TextboxTag.Text = ""; TextBoxDescricao.Text = ""; opcaoAcesso = new classeOpcaoAcesso(); }
public MySqlDataAdapter selectOpcaoAcessoBase(classeOpcaoAcesso OpcaoAcesso) { string sql = $"select * from opcaoacesso where opcaoacessoid = {OpcaoAcesso.Codigo};"; return(connect.retornaSQL(sql)); }
public void excluiOpcaoAcessoBase(classeOpcaoAcesso OpcaoAcesso) { string sql = $"delete from opcaoacesso where opcaoacessoid = {OpcaoAcesso.Codigo};"; connect.executaSQL(sql); }
public void alteraOpcaoAcessoBase(classeOpcaoAcesso OpcaoAcesso) { string sql = $"update opcaoacesso set opcaoacessotag = {OpcaoAcesso.CodigoTag}, opcaoacessodescricao = '{OpcaoAcesso.Descricao}' where opcaoacessoid = {OpcaoAcesso.Codigo};"; connect.executaSQL(sql); }
public void insereOpcaoAcessoBase(classeOpcaoAcesso OpcaoAcesso) { string sql = $"insert into opcaoacesso (opcaoacessotag, opcaoacessodescricao) values ({OpcaoAcesso.CodigoTag},'{OpcaoAcesso.Descricao}');"; connect.executaSQL(sql); }